For years,high-deductible health plans have been the most common type of healthinsurance that employers offer. HDHPs surged in popularity between 2013 and 2021, peaking at 55.7% enrollment. But in a sharp reversal, enrollment in these plans has now fallen for two consecutive years, dipping to 49.7%
A new report has concluded that the Affordable Care Act, which took full effect in 2013, did not result in a significant change in the number of employers offering healthinsurance, although the rate at which small employers offered coverage declined slightly by 2.6 percentage points between 2013 and 2020.

Health FSA Limits The Affordable Care Act (ACA) imposes a dollar limit on employees’ salary reduction contributions to health FSAs. 1, 2013, and has been adjusted for inflation for subsequent plan years. This limit started as $2,500 for plan years beginning on or after Jan.
